Limb Disposal Requirements Relaxed for week of March 18 on Normal Collection Days

(COLUMBIA, MO) -

Due to the large number of limbs felled during the recent winter storms, the Columbia Public Works Department will provide one-time special limb collection and relax length requirements for limb disposal. This will occur on your normal collection day ONLY during the week of March 18 providing the following requirements are met:

  • The customer must call Solid Waste at (573) 874-6291 at least 24 hours in advance to schedule the special one-time collection of oversized limbs. Street department personnel and equipment will be assisting Solid Waste. For the special pickup, refuse crews and trucks won't be picking up the oversize materials. Street division crews with dump trucks and backhoes will handle the oversize items.
  • Limbs no more than 8 feet in length must be placed curbside for pickup.  Crews are not able to collect limbs if they are not placed curbside.
  • Limbs longer than 4 feet but no more than 8 feet in length are not required to be bundled.

Customers have other options to dispose of limbs:

  • Limbs which are bundled and do not exceed 4 feet in length, 2 feet in diameter, and 50 pounds per bundle, may be placed curbside on your normal collection day anytime during the year.
  • Limbs and other brush may be taken to one of three mulch or compost areas free of charge. The Parkside and Capen Park mulch sites are open dawn to dusk daily for non-commercial use only. The Compost facility at the Landfill is open 7 a.m.-4 p.m. Monday-Friday and 8 a.m.-2 p.m. Saturday. 


Parkside Mulch Site, Parkside Drive just off Creasy Springs RoadCapen Park Mulch Site, 1600 Capen Park DriveLandfill Compost Facility, 5700 Peabody Road

It must be stressed that customers who wish to place limbs which exceed 4 feet but are no more than 8 feet in length curbside for collection on their normal refuse collection day during the week of March 18 MUST call the Solid Waste Division at least 24 hours in advance to schedule this special pick-up. Regular refuse and recycling trucks cannot process materials in excess of 4 feet and thus will not be able to pick up oversized limbs.
